MAPBPIP Activators

MAPBPIP activators are a class of compounds that enhance the functional activity of MAPBPIP, a protein implicated in lysosome biogenesis and endosome-lysosome trafficking. These activators exert their effects by modulating distinct biochemical pathways that regulate the function of MAPBPIP. They include compounds such as Rapamycin and Curcumin, which influence the mTOR and NRF2 pathways respectively, leading to enhanced MAPBPIP functional activity. Other compounds such as Forskolin and Resveratrol modulate the AC and PI3K/AKT pathways respectively, leading to increased MAPBPIP activity.

Capsaicin and Genistein, for example, work through the TRPV1 and PI3K/AKT pathways respectively, promoting MAPBPIP function. Berberine and Salicylic Acid are also part of this class, impacting AMPK pathway to upregulate MAPBPIP. Another compound, Caffeine, influences the PDE pathway, leading to enhanced MAPBPIP functionality. Quercetin and Berberine affect the PI3K/AKT and AMPK pathways respectively, leading to enhanced MAPBPIP activity.
